How do you fill a Bezier curve in Inkscape?

You need to make your shape into a closed path, otherwise the fill won’t work the way you want it to. Next, select the Bézier tool Shift + F6 , and hold it over one of the end nodes. When it turns red, click on it to continue the path and attach it to the other open end node.

Which key should you press to create a corner node when drawing a Bezier curve?

While drawing the Ctrl key while dragging will push the handles both ways. The Alt key will create a sharp corner, and the Shift key will allow you to make a handle while at the end of the curve.

How do I edit text in SVG?

Here are the steps to edit an svg file with Inkscape.

  1. Create a New Document, go to the main menu bar at the top, select “File” and click on “New”.
  2. Import your svg file using the “Import” function.
  3. Use the drawing or text tools to make amendments.
  4. Click on the “Text and Font” tool to change your font in the text panel.

How do you use the Bezier tool in Inkscape?

Click the Bezier tool, press the letter b on your keyboard, or press Shift + F6 to activate the Bezier tool. Click the BSpline icon. Click where you want to begin your curved line, drag to where you want a curve, click again, drag to where you want another curve, click again. Continue until you have completed your path.

How do I use the Bezier tool on my computer?

Click the Bezier tool, press the letter b on your keyboard, or press Shift + F6 to activate it. Click the Bezier path icon. To create straight lines, click where you want to start a line, click again where you want to end it.

How do you make a curve in Inkscape?

Click where you want to begin your curved line, drag to where you want a curve, click again, drag to where you want another curve, click again. Continue until you have completed your path. The blue line shows the shape of the path. Click and then press Enter, double-click, or right-click to end the path.
